???? Real Test Data: Proven Slip Resistance

Our cork flooring was tested using the ASTM E303 British Pendulum Test, one of the most trusted methods for measuring surface friction.

???? Source:

Test Results:

  • Dry Condition: BPN 50
  • Wet Condition: BPN 43

What this means:

  • ✔️ Excellent grip when dry
  • ???? Reliable, safe performance when wet
  • ❗ Maintains traction better than many hard surfaces

???? Understanding Slip Ratings (Simple)

BPN Value Slip Risk
0–24 High risk (dangerous)
25–35 Moderate
36–45 Low risk
45+ High safety / strong grip

???? Cork scores:

  • 50 (Dry) → High safety
  • 43 (Wet) → Low slip riskAnti-Slip Resilient Cork Flooring Proven Slip Resistance

⚖️ Cork vs Other Flooring Types

Here’s how cork compares to common alternatives:

???? Cork Flooring (Your Product)

  • Dry: BPN 50 ✔️
  • Wet: BPN 43 ????
  • Natural micro-texture + elasticity = better traction
  • Softer surface reduces injury risk if someone falls

???? Best balance of safety + comfort

 


???? Vinyl Flooring (LVP / SPC / WPC)

  • Typical wet BPN: 35–45
  • Can feel plastic-slick, especially with water or dust
  • Heavily dependent on surface embossing

⚠️ Issue:

  • Lower friction when wet compared to cork
  • Hard surface = higher injury risk

???? Laminate Flooring

  • Typical wet BPN: 30–40
  • Surface is melamine-coated (smooth)
  • Becomes slippery when wet

⚠️ Issue:

  • One of the most slippery common flooring types
  • Not recommended for moisture-prone areas

⬜ Tile (Ceramic / Porcelain)

  • Wide range: 30–60+
  • Polished tile = extremely slippery
  • Textured tile = good grip but hard surface

⚠️ Issue:

  • Hardest surface → highest injury risk
  • Cold + unforgiving

???? Why Cork Wins for Safety

1. Natural Grip

Cork has a microscopic cellular structure that creates friction naturally — not just a surface coating.

2. Resilient Surface

Unlike tile or laminate, cork compresses slightly underfoot, increasing traction.

3. Safer Falls

If a fall does happen:

  • Cork absorbs impact
  • Reduces injury compared to hard surfaces
